These Regulations may be cited as the Environmental Management (Access and Benefit Sharing of Genetic Resources) Regulations, 2024. These Regulations apply to access and benefit sharing involving genetic resources, associated traditional knowledge, and naturally occurring or naturalised breeds in Tanzania and beyond Tanzania, subject to listed exceptions. This section defines key terms used in the Regulations. These Regulations aim to set procedures for access to genetic resources, promote sustainable use of biodiversity, support benefit-sharing, increase public awareness, and recognise and protect local communities’ rights over genetic resources and related traditional knowledge. The government holds the right to determine, control, and regulate access to genetic resources and associated traditional knowledge in Tanzania.
